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.
Audi A4 Avant is considerably cheaper – starting at 37,200 £ , while the Ferrari 296 Roadster costs 396,000 £ . That’s a price difference of around 358,758 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Audi A4 Avant uses 4.8 L/100km and is clearly more efficient than the Ferrari 296 Roadster with 8.9 L/100km. The difference is about 4.1 L/100km.
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.
When it comes to engine power, the Ferrari 296 Roadster offers significantly more power – delivering 880 HP compared to 470 HP. That’s roughly 410 HP more horsepower.
When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Ferrari 296 Roadster is clearly quicker – completing the sprint in 2.8 s, while the Audi A4 Avant takes 3.7 s. That’s about 0.9 s quicker.
There’s also a difference in torque: the Ferrari 296 Roadster delivers visibly more torque with 755 Nm compared to 600 Nm. That’s about 155 Nm more.
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?
Seats: Audi A4 Avant offers more seats – 5 vs 2.
In terms of curb weight, Audi A4 Avant is somewhat lighter – 1,595 kg compared to 1,760 kg. The difference is around 165 kg.
When it comes to payload, the Audi A4 Avant carries significantly more – 565 kg compared to 220 kg. That’s a difference of about 345 kg.
